Gossip is a feature-rich social networking platform designed to connect people through shared interests, groups, and personal interactions. The platform combines traditional social networking capabilities with modern features like gamification, real-time interactions, and comprehensive privacy controls.

The application follows a layered architecture:
- Presentation Layer: API endpoints and WebSocket connections
- Business Logic Layer: Controllers and services
- Data Access Layer: Models and database interactions
- Infrastructure Layer: Cross-cutting concerns like logging, caching, security
